Chlorine in PDB 4f62: Crystal Structure of A Putative Farnesyl-Diphosphate Synthase From Marinomonas Sp. MED121 (Target Efi-501980)

Protein crystallography data

The structure of Crystal Structure of A Putative Farnesyl-Diphosphate Synthase From Marinomonas Sp. MED121 (Target Efi-501980), PDB code: 4f62 was solved by M.W.Vetting, R.Toro, R.Bhosle, N.F.Al Obaidi, E.Washington, A.Scott Glenn, S.Chowdhury, B.Evans, J.Hammonds, B.Hillerich, J.Love, R.D.Seidel, H.J.Imker, C.D.Poulter, J.A.Gerlt, S.C.Almo, Enzyme Function Initiative(Efi), with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 41.06 / 2.10
Space group P 32 2 1
Cell size a, b, c (Å), α, β, γ (°) 96.491, 96.491, 156.390, 90.00, 90.00, 120.00
R / Rfree (%) 17.7 / 20.3
